using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.IO;
using System.Linq;
using System.Text;
using System.Windows.Forms;
namespace docx生成
{
public partial class Form1 : Form
{
public Form1()
{
InitializeComponent();
}
private void button1_Click(object sender, EventArgs e)
{
string ss = txt1.Text.Trim();
string[] sslist = ss.Split('\n');
if (sslist.Length > 0)
{
for (int i = 0; i < sslist.Length; i++)
{
//MessageBox.Show(sslist[i]);
string pLocalFilePath = @"C:\111\1.docx";
string pSaveFilePath = @"C:\111\" + sslist[i].Trim() + ".docx";
//MessageBox.Show(pSaveFilePath);
File.Copy(pLocalFilePath, pSaveFilePath, true);//三个参数分别是源文件路径,存储路径,若存储路径有相同文件是否替换
}
}
}
private void txt1_KeyUp(object sender, KeyEventArgs e)
{
if (e.Modifiers == Keys.Control && e.KeyCode == Keys.A)
{
((TextBox)sender).SelectAll();
}
}
private void button2_Click(object sender, EventArgs e)
{
this.Close();
}
private void button3_Click(object sender, EventArgs e)
{
string ss = txt1.Text.Trim();
string[] sslist = ss.Split('\n');
if (sslist.Length > 0)
{
for (int i = 0; i < sslist.Length; i++)
{
string dir = @"C:\111\" + sslist[i].Trim();
if (!Directory.Exists(dir))//如果不存在就创建 dir 文件夹
Directory.CreateDirectory(dir);
}
}
}
}
}